Ali.
Reviewed: 06 January 2006

RELATIVE BARGAIN

Clean horrifically dirty chains without having to take them off so saves on snap off Shimano pins.
Cheaper than Park as said below.
Really does save a fair amount of time
Citrus stuff that comes with is rubbish, Finish Line EcoTech instead in use.
Takes a while to get the knack of using it without making it fall apart or the chain fall out of it.
Might well conspire to break one day.
Has lasted a good long time. A bit of a time saver as even with a chain caked in crap, a few minutes of back pedaling will have to it good as new. For the time and effort it saves, well worth it.

Steven Alderdice
Reviewed: 12 August 2004

CLEANS WITH SIDE EFFECTS

Gets chain very clean
Cheaper than the Park version
Always falls off the chain
Citrus cleaner you get with it it crap
It gets the chain sparkling clean when you use it with white spirit or other organic solvents so cant fault it. It does however have a tendency to fall off the chain spilling oily mess everywhere is a pain.
